DIY Fixes for Baggy Crotches

Dart it Up:
Darts are a tailor’s secret weapon for eliminating excess fabric and creating a custom fit. To create a dart in the crotch, simply pinch the fabric at the apex of the bulge and stitch a diagonal line towards the waistband. Repeat this process on the other side of the crotch for a snug fit.

Add a Gusset:
A gusset is a diamond-shaped piece of fabric that can be inserted into the crotch to provide additional support and prevent sagging. Create a gusset using matching fabric and sew it into the crotch seam. This technique is particularly effective for loose-fitting jeans.

Expert Tips: A Professional Approach

Adjust the Waistband:
If the baggy crotch is accompanied by a loose waistband, consider taking in the jeans at the sides. This will pull the entire garment closer to your body, reducing excess fabric in the crotch area.

Reshape the Crotch:
A skilled tailor can carefully reshape the crotch by adjusting the seams and darts. This is a more permanent solution that ensures a perfect fit for the long term.

FAQs: Unraveling Baggy Crotch Mysteries

  1. Q: Can I fix a baggy crotch on stretchy jeans?

    A: Yes, you can use the darting or gusset method on stretchy jeans, but be sure to use a fabric that matches the stretchiness of the original material.
  2. Q: How to prevent a baggy crotch when buying new jeans?

    A: Try on jeans in different sizes and styles to find the pair that fits your body type best. Pay attention to the fit in the crotch area to ensure it’s not too wide or loose.
  3. Q: Is it better to fix a baggy crotch or buy new jeans?

    A: The decision depends on the severity of the bagginess and the age of the jeans. If the jeans are relatively new and the bagginess is minimal, attempting a repair is worthwhile. Otherwise, purchasing new jeans may be a better option.
